What exactly are we talking about here? There was no limited production WS6 in 1997. There were no factory stripes. There were 2,827 WS6 T/A coupes built and 463 WS6 T/A convertibles built in 1997. That's about 1/2 of the total T/A's built that year, and the largest number of WS6's built until the 2002 model year.
